Moving towards reduced emissions – Zero Carbon 2040, fossil-free 2030

The transport sector is one of the most polluting in both Estonia and the European Union.

As part of the international Posti Group, Itella aims to be a zero carbon company by 2040. Posti is globally the first and the only company in its industry to have its net-zero targets approved by The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i).

  • The company consistently invests in the development of environmentally sustainable parcel transport solutions.
  • To make our parcel transport service more environmentally friendly, we will introduce electric vans. The first of these vans started delivering parcels in autumn 2022. In the same year, we switched 10 parcel vans to Neste My Renewable Diesel fuel – thanks to this fuel a company can reduce its carbon footprint by up to 90% compared to using conventional fossil fuels.
  • Our new terminal will offer the possibility to charge electric vehicles. Once we have adopted our electric charging infrastructure, we will start to gradually increase the number of electric vans in the company’s fleet.
  • To reduce the ecological footprint of our parcel transport service, we will optimise Smartpost Itella’s parcel delivery rounds to reduce the mileage, time and noise of each parcel round, thereby saving the environment.
  • Our employees can use the employee bus to commute to work from near their home at the employer’s expense so that people do not have to use private cars.
